Coldplay breathes life into HK’s dream to be a major Asia concert hub


Coldplay is playing four nights in Hong Kong, from April 8 to 12, as part of its Music of the Spheres World Tour. -- ST PHOTO: MAGDALENE FUNG

HONG KONG (The Straits Times/ANN): Hong Kong appears to be off to a solid start in its bid to become a top concert destination in Asia, with British rock band Coldplay as the first major international act to perform at the city’s new mega stadium on April 8.

But the jury is still out on whether Hong Kong can rival other established concert venues in the region, such as Australia, Japan and Singapore.
